## Formula sandbox tuning

User-supplied formulas in Gridmoor execute inside a restricted interpreter with hard ceilings on time, memory, and call depth. Reviewers should confirm any change to these ceilings is justified in the PR description, since raising them widens the abuse surface. Defaults were chosen from production traces. The current limits are as follows.

limits module of tafog-fawip:
WEIGHTS = {
    "julix": 57,
    "lamys": 992,
    "kasvan": 209,
    "quenok": 750,
    "alddor": 259,
    "oliath": 1009,
    "wenix": 815,
}

Handover — Fenwick to on-call. The Paydrift integration suite has been flaking on the settlement tests since Tuesday. Root cause appears to be a race between the mock clearing house and the retry scheduler: tests pass when the mock responds under 200ms. I've quarantined the three worst offenders; do not un-quarantine them without fixing the fixture timing. If the suite blocks a release, rerun with the serial flag as a stopgap. Full notes, repro steps, and the quarantine list are kept on the page below.

operations page: https://jenkins.zemvarcloud.local/job/merge_requests/repo/build/73930b4b30f0a8ed

This PR rolls out the new consent banner for Wrenbury Shop across all regions behind the `consent_v3` flag. Changes: banner component, region-aware copy loading, and a dismissal-persistence fix. Rollout is staged by percentage with automatic halt if dismissal errors spike. Nothing here touches the preference-storage backend. For review, the staged rollout and timing constants are configured as follows.

tuning table, yajog-yahof:
BUDGETS = {
    "lamvan": 303,
    "wenox": 460,
    "fenvan": 525,
}